There were tears in those human’s eyes. But that monster’s face was impossible to sympathize with.

"You?! Hachi must have told you!" Minato growled. His goat legs pushed him forward in a blinding speed.

The Mantis Blades sliced at Carter once more. However, it was still stopped. A faint white aura protected Carter.

"It’s futile. Why don’t you understand?"

Carter flicked his finger at Minato once more. He flew away like a fly and crushed beneath the rocks of the wall.

The man didn’t even turn back. He dug it way up and ran away.

His mind might be tortured for many years but his sharp sense was still there. That white-haired girl, whoever she was, showed him a power he couldn’t resist again.

He had his freedom in his hands. As soon as he ran away from here, he could build everything again. Another Demonic Poison Sect. Another influential political force. And once more, he would be the Grandmaster that everyone feared.

Carter bent his index finger. Minato shot back down to the well and rolled a few times.

He coughed out a lot of blood.

"What do you want from me, witch?!" He roared. His voice was rasp.

Carter approached him. His entire body gently glowed like he was some sort of saint.

The white-haired maiden in the white Hakama sat down. She reached her hands at him.

Minato jerked back at first but let her touch his cheeks. He heard something so he looked up.

Two glimmered lines on her face. Lines of tear.

"What... Why are you crying?" Minato widened his eyes.

"I saw your past." Carter placed his thumb on Minato’s forehead.

They were transported back to a scene in the past. This wasn’t true time travel, only an illusion to show the events that had long passed.

Minato stood there. Underneath him were pile of corpses. Those that came to kill him died. And he survived.

He was a genius Fighter since the earlier day.

Then another memory. Minato created his own Martial Art, called the Demonic Poison, the same name of the sect he would name in his future.

He lost his way. Instead of leaning onto his talent, he found shortcut. That shortcut was poison. Poison killed fast. Poison killed without sound. Poison killed without knowing.

Murasaki Minato gained the name, the Cruel Demon of the East. He would do anything to win.

Then time passed by. He created the Demonic Poison Sect, married his wife, who was the most beautiful woman at the time. But they couldn’t have kids.

So he poured his fatherly instinct toward his students. Those that he would teach like a father. But would also punish like enemies.

Among those students were Hachi. A farm boy with no last name. He had no high origins like Minato but he was a lot like him. Hachi had talents and he’s smart.

But Minato didn’t understand that those harsh punishments he gave and the cruelty he passed on daily would plant a seed in Hachi.

And without his knowledge, Hachi also took an interest in his wife, who was still the most beautiful woman at the time, despite her age.

Hachi defiled her, causing her to have his baby.

Minato killed his wife and the unborn child. Then he killed all his official students because the betrayal of one. Minato was slowly and slowly became more deranged.

That was when he had lost. For many years past, Minato thought back to that moment. Poison killed fast. Poison killed without sound. And poison killed without knowing. And Hachi had found a poison that Minato couldn’t even think of.

The poison of the mind. It was not figuratively. It was literally a poison that could affect the mind.

Did Hachi had feeling for Minato’s wife? Yes, but no more than a play thing. He did what he did just because that would cause the poison to spread deeper, lowering Minato’s own strength.

Once the plan had worked, Hachi struck. Minato lost.

And he lost everything. His family. His students. His sect. And his fame.

But Hachi didn’t kill him. He kept him alive to further experiment on Minato. He didn’t do it out of vengeance either. He just did it because it amuse him.

Minato lost because there was someone even crueler than him.

The monster knelt down and cried too. This time the white-haired swordsman hugged him. Her body was still glowing white so Minato couldn’t even hurt him if he wanted to.

’Ah... Crying emotional scene. Haven’t do this in a while.’

"You are cruel, Minato. And you deserve judgment. But what you’ve gone through exceeded for more than anything you have done."

The Transcension Aura flooded within Minato. He widened his eyes and looked at the white-haired girl in surprise.

Her skin was breaking.

"I shall give you another chance. A chance to redeem the past. A chance to become something more. And a chance for revenge."

The turtle shell detached itself. The Mantis Arms melted away like acid. The goat turned to ash and a new pair of human leg slowly returned.

His face. That of a monster. Was no more.

"What did I do to deserve such forgiveness?"

"You don’t." Carter’s soft voice echoed. "And that’s why you will have to prove it for forevermore. You shall become the second Guardian of the Shrine. Your mission, should you choose to accept, is to protect this world."

Minato gulped. He bowed down. His hands wrapped around the white-haired girl’s knee like a child.

"Master..."

This title was for a teacher. A parent. Someone that you looked up to. Not the master of a slave.

And that was what exactly Minato thought of her. He was moved.

The maiden pointed her hand at Minato’s chest and drew. A single word appeared.

"Shall this guide you in the future. And shall this always remind you of your responsibility." Carter’s soft voice echoed.

"I, Murasaki Minato, will protect this world from this moment on and forever more. If I betray this vow, have the sky crush my soul, and the earth bury my spirit."

The word etched on his skin and his soul. His vow had been acknowledged. He earned his second chance by swearing under a Transcendent and received the approval of the World.
